Zero downtime software upgrade

The procedure below describes a cluster with three. To face this challenge the oracle has come up with a best practice called zero downtime database upgrademigrate using goldengate steps to do achieve zero downtime upgrade. Zero downtime upgrades for jira software data center. Net core if youre using octopus deploy and aws with their elastic load balancer v2 in front of ec2 instances that either self host or sit behind iis, you can setup zero downtime deployments fairly easily. In case of emergency, each usbelicenser registered on mysteinberg permits you to submit one online request for a steinberg zero downtime license which can then be stored on a spare usbelicenser and allows you to use your steinberg software for another 25 operating hours this extension provides the opportunity to apply for a permanent replacement. The zero downtime method provides the following features for missioncritical deployments. Cisco asa 5500 activestandby zero downtime upgrade. Jan 18, 2019 the zero downtime option comes along with the standard tool for software maintenance. This step includes software upgrade of the secondary node and restart of the node. Zero downtime oracle grid infrastructure patching enables patching of oracle grid infrastructure without interrupting database operations.

Figure 1 illustrates how hpe shadowbase software can achieve zero application downtime via a multinode upgrade or a singlesystem upgrade. Upgrading oracle siebel crm application without downtime. Zerodowntime rolling updates with kubernetes sebastian. The zero downtime option intends to support customer update or customer upgrade activities on a regular basis.

There are many factors that will impact software downtime. The procedure below describes a cluster with three members. I do this during off hours, so it isnt a huge problem but it is something id like to get away from. Zero downtime database upgrade from 12c to 19c using.

Depending on the dispatcher implementation router, software proxy, etc. The secondary system can be initially installed with the new software version or upgraded to the new software version when the replication has already been configured. To achieve a zero downtime deployment, the software should be built considering the factors that do not demand any downtime. Faq near zero downtime maintenance nzdm abap software. These range from a basic unidirectional model, which is designed to work outofthebox, to the most sophisticated activeactive model for phased migrations. During a regular upgrade process in a high availability setup, at some point, both nodes run different software builds.

Before you decided which method is appropriate for use when upgrading your. Unfortunately, most software has to store the data somewhere. Before you upgrade a unified access gateway appliance, the quiesce mode in the unified access gateway system configuration pages is changed from no to yes when the quiesce mode value is yes, the unified access gateway appliance is shown as not available when the load balancer checks the health. Us9229707b2 zero downtime mechanism for software upgrade. Take web server a out of the load balancer, upgrade it, put it back online, then repeat for web server b. Patches are applied outofplace and in a rolling fashion, with one node being patched at a time, while the database instances on the node remain operational. The zero downtime technology is integrated in sum software update manager.

A webbased application with apachephp for serverside processing and mysql dbfilesystem for persistence. This will allow us to bring down one node at a time, upgrade, and bring. May 31, 2016 unfortunately, most software has to store the data somewhere. Zero downtime database upgrade using oracle goldengate 4i. There are numerous methods to upgrade a database, and most depend on the original version and final version. Use sap hana system replication for near zero downtime. Before we go into the details of how to change the schema in such a way that zero downtime deployment is possible lets focus on schema versioning first.

In our most recent release of jira software data center, we introduced zero downtime upgrades, allowing you to upgrade one node at a time and let users continue to work without interruption. Infor syteline erp manufacturing software or infor eam software and demos call 5864644400 or visit. Sharepoint server 2016 zero downtime patching steps. Migrate casino application environments with zero downtime. For additional information on the tool impact analysis, see sap community blog impact analysis as part of software update manager 2. Software engineering stack exchange is a question and answer site for professionals, academics, and students working within the systems development life cycle. First, back up your configuration by going to tools backup configurations. Changes in this release for oracle grid infrastructure. In the modern software landscape it is increasingly important, even expected, that services be upgraded without causing downtime to the end. Developers and application architects must think about how applications should be structured within containers and how those containers should be managed as clusters.

The database footprint is rather small since not the entire database will be cloned. The following table shows the base versions of remedy from which you. If you need to include or to exclude single tables. The zero downtime upgrade method is available as an option for those who want to upgrade with very little disruption to their original deployment and the services that are provided to internal and external customers. Zero downtime doesnt happen automatically when you move applications into continuous operations. Id love to be able to upgrade one web server at a time. Achieving zero downtime deployment touched on the same issue but i need some advice on a strategy that i am considering context. Thats why you have to think twice before doing any sort of schema changes. In this blog i describe the zero downtime option approach which is part of software update manager 2. Zero downtime upgrade on a cluster check point software. The zero downtime upgrade method the upgrade mode that allows the nodes of your jira cluster to run on different versions of jira while you upgrade them one by one.

Followings are the db version for the past heat releases. Apr 29, 2016 in the same vein as my last post, this update will take you through the steps of performing a zero downtime upgrade on a ha pair of asa 5525xs, this time via the asdm gui. This leads to a small amount of downtime each month about 30 mins. In dryrun upgrade mode, the installation wizard performs all of the system readiness checks that it would perform in an actual upgrade and enables you to verify whether your system is ready for. How to include or exclude tables from the data transfer. After one year of performing zdo upgrades in several customer pilot projects we. Most cloud databases offer zero downtime for maintenance activities such as software upgrades by allowing rolling upgrades. Introduction to the zero downtime upgrade method oracle docs.

Zero downtime upgrades let you upgrade unified access gateway with no downtime for the users. Jun 04, 2019 most cloud databases offer zero downtime for maintenance activities such as software upgrades by allowing rolling upgrades. Each version of my software will need to execute against a different version of the database so i am sort of stuck. During zero downtime patching, users can add and edit files and use search just as at any other time, accessing the servers still handled by the load balancer.

Zero downtime upgrade is supported on all check point clusters and thirdparty clustering products. Zero downtime option of sum zdo is available on request. Download the desired target version from downloads 2. Zero downtime patching is a method of patching and upgrade developed in sharepoint online. Sep 16, 20 infor eam asset management software zero downtime upgrade technology overview video. Zero downtime deployments with octopus deploy codeopinion. Check network between source and target install goldengate software both side setup extract and datapump on source site setup replict on target side export and import initial load using scn start the replicat using on scn step. Before you upgrade a unified access gateway appliance, the quiesce mode in the unified access gateway system configuration pages is changed from no to yes.

Infor eam asset management software zero downtime upgrade. Zdm will connect to source and target with the provided ssh keys. Likewise, though the database schemas may differ between the patched and unpatched sides of the farm, sharepoint server 2016 operates in a backwardcompatible mode, and its databases are. Zero downtime deployments with octopus deploy march 21, 2018 march 21, 2018 derek comartin. To achieve a zero downtime deployment, the software should be built.

Many enterprises have moved their workloads to kubernetes, which has been built with productionreadiness in mind. The distributed system that is upgraded during this process may have architecture similar to the architecture of system 100, according to one embodiment of the invention. Starting with oracle grid infrastructure 19c, the oracle grid infrastructure installation wizard gridsetup. In other words, all existing data connections are lost, which leads to downtime. Some of the deployments are going to require careful planning and of course the nature of the backend database can complicate things a bit.

Upgrade with zero downtime is a special method available for jira data center. The zero downtime methodology is an alternative to the inplace upgrade methodology that is described in part ii and part iii of this book. Zero downtime option of software update manager sap blogs. This works by essentially allowing the nodes of your cluster to run on different version of jira simultaneously while youre upgrading. The zero downtime upgrade methodology is also known as an outofplace upgrade for reasons that are described in this chapter. There are a number of things involved in making this happen. Video demo of zero downtime patching in sharepoint server 2016. Like this the two systems can get back in sync before the takeover step. Will i still be able to do a zero downtime upgrade.

Join benjamin king, solutions engineer, and dick wiggers, jira software developer, to get a technical deep dive into jira software data center and zero. With this release, zero downtime upgrade is supported only if you are upgrading from version 7. Here lets assume we have a database 10g in the source needs to be upgraded to 12c in target. In both cases, the new upgraded database and the current database are kept synchronized by shadowbase data replication, so that if an issue arises with the new system, it is easy to revert to the current. In service software upgrade support for high availability. How to use containers for continuous operations and zero.

Zdm proceeds to establish connectivity between the sourceprimary database and the oracle. However, it is a good idea to perform the data backup tasks in table 153 before you create and populate the new branch in the ldap directory server during the zero downtime upgrade. In case of emergency, each usbelicenser registered on mysteinberg permits you to submit one online request for a steinberg zero downtime license which can then be stored on a spare usbelicenser and allows you to use your steinberg software for another 25 operating hours. During this type of upgrade, there is always at least one active member that handles traffic. For more information, see prepare an update for flexible system downtime. Its pretty obvious that in 2018 there needs to be many instances of the software running, not only for zero downtime deployment purposes but for general availability and scalability. Preparing for zerodowntime upgrade of the platform. During the upgrade, jira remains fully functional and open to your users. The motivation of zdo is to perform maintenance events i. First you need to upload the software to the flash memory on both firewalls. How do developers make zero downtime deployments possible. It introduces the upgrade mode that allows your nodes to work on different jira versions while you upgrade them one by one. Infor syteline erp manufacturing software or infor eam software and demos.

Use sap hana system replication for near zero downtime upgrades. Remove downtime with jira software data center atlassian. Time expenditure for the data comparison is higher. A new release of software should not bring down the system. From the release notes i understand that in order to perform a zero downtime upgrade i need to upgrade from the last minor release in a ma. Oct 21, 2016 the steps in this article and information about zero downtime patching also apply to sharepoint server 2019. How to minimize upgrade downtime during an sap upgrade project. The downtime for software upgrade to sap s4hana and migration can be minimized by the near zero downtime approach. This topic is to bring about what and how to attain a zero downtime database upgrade with the technology oracle goldengate introduction to oracle goldengate. Us20100162226a1 zero downtime mechanism for software. With the new downtimeminimized upgrade procedure zero downtime option of sum zdo, you can expect a downtime reduced to only one restart. For the near zero downtime upgrade to work, the operation mode on the secondary system is automatically set to logreplay. Leveraging zero downtime option of sum for sap s4hana.

Goldengate software was founded in 1995 and was acquired by oracle in 2009. Home asa cisco asa 5500 activestandby zero downtime upgrade. Oracle goldengate provides three different deployment models for siebel crm zero downtime upgrades that are designed to meet differing customer requirements. Upgrade the database schema for the version of the app being deployed. Zero downtime upgrade faqs atlassian documentation confluence. Zero downtime select this option if you cannot have any network downtime and need to complete the upgrade quickly, with a minimal number of dropped connections. The issu upgrade process in a high availability setup consists of the following steps. Zero downtime upgrades for jira data center applications. Of course, i first make a backup of the old version. Dec 05, 2016 the downtime for software upgrade to sap s4hana and migration can be minimized by the near zero downtime approach.

A zerodowntime database upgrade enables true rolling upgrades of the glance nodes in your clouds control plane. First you need to upload the software to the flash memory on both firewalls, you can either connect to the asa via command line and tftp them there, or connect to the asdm and upload them from your pclaptop. This works by essentially allowing the nodes of your cluster to run on different version of. It was made to let administrators patch the service at the same time as users kept using their subscriptions. In this article we are going to see zero downtime database upgrade from 12c to 19c using oracle goldengate environment details. Simple, automated, one button approach solution for moving your oracle databases into the oracle cloud. I do not want to upgrade the tomcat application server because my version 7. Zdm runs on oracle linux 7 or above, and should be run on a separate server. How to perform an oracle database upgrade with near zero. In addition to delaying webgate upgrades, you can delay upgrading the software developer kit sdk. At the appropriate point in the upgrade, you can have a mixed deployment of release n for example, ocata and release n1 for example, newton glance nodes, take the n1 release nodes out of rotation, allow them to drain, and then take them out of service permanently, leaving. Theres no additional license needed and of course no separate tool required.

Heat is provided with db migration tool and each heat major release is provided with given db version. In service software upgrade support for high availability for performing zero downtime upgrade. It has to be comfortable in use with minimum costs and acceptable effort for the it team. This section discusses system downtime in the context of an sap upgrade project. If you have an anyconnect xml profile take a backup of that also ive. This step includes software upgrade of the new secondary node and restart of the node. More details on how to handle the db zero down time upgrade is elaborated in this document. Zero downtime database upgrade from 12c to 19c using oracle. Upgrading jira data center with zero downtime atlassian. In order to stay competitive, new software versions need to be rolled out as soon as possible, without disrupting active users. Managing a zero downtime upgrade for jira data center. Zero downtime upgrade support, preconfiguration tasks, and rollback. During a zero downtime upgrade, one cluster member remains active, while the other cluster members get upgraded. Second, after you finish the patch phase, you must complete the update installation by starting the buildtobuild upgrade phase.

With service pack 1 and later, you can upgrade the platform components directly on the production server with zero downtime zdt. In service software upgrade support for high availability for. Additionally, the zdo procedure decreases the cool down duration. I have a pair of asa5585x in an activestandby failover configuration. Data in the original branch of the directory server is not modified during a zero downtime upgrade.

In rolling upgrades, a few nodes are upgraded at a time while the rest of the nodes serve the production operations. With this method, jira remains fully functional whilst youre upgrading. Infor eam asset management software zero downtime upgrade technology overview video. Fill in the zdm template file and start migration via the zdmcli command line. Zero downtime deployments with containers dzone devops. How to achieve zero downtime rolling updates with kubernetes.

919 731 254 482 497 1313 1277 918 119 592 903 774 1146 973 912 722 1208 154 430 1055 743 1117 143 445 894 275 1133 549 412 797 971 60